The digital realm exposes us to a deluge of information, often leaving our mental processes strained. Consequently, we are susceptible to a range of psychological biases that can substantially distort our understanding of online content. These biases, commonly implicit, can lead us to favorably process information that supports our pre-existing beliefs, while dismissing opposing viewpoints.

  • One such bias is confirmation bias, where we tend to favor information that supports our existing beliefs, even if it is inaccurate.
  • Availability heuristic can also come into play, leading us to overestimate the likelihood of events that are vivid. This can result in exaggerated perceptions of risk or threat based on recent news stories or social media.

In conclusion, being mindful of these cognitive biases is critical for processing online information effectively. By analyzing the sources we engage with and actively seeking out diverse perspectives, we can reduce the influence of these biases and form more reliable judgments.

The Psychology of Web Design for Mental Wellbeing

The design of a website can significantly impact user mental wellbeing. A well-designed site promotes feelings of calmness, while a poorly designed one can cause anxiety. Factors like palette, style, and visual selection all play a role in shaping the audience's emotional experience.

  • For example, using calming colors like blue can reduce feelings of stress.
  • Intuitive navigation helps users feel confident, reducing feelings of overwhelm.
  • High-quality, relatable images can evoke positive emotions.

By understanding the psychology behind web design, creators can build online experiences that are not only practical but also supportive to user mental health.

Ethical Considerations in AI and Women's Data Privacy

The rise here of artificial intelligence (AI) presents both unprecedented opportunities and considerable ethical challenges. , Particularly, the privacy of women's data is a crucial concern that demands urgent attention. AI algorithms are increasingly used to process vast amounts of user data, which can expose sensitive information about individuals, including women. This raises substantial concerns about the possibility of , prejudice against women based on their online activities and . behaviours.

  • Consider this, AI-powered facial recognition systems have been shown to misidentify women of color more frequently than men.
  • Furthermore, systems trained on unrepresentative datasets can perpetuate existing gender stereotypes and disparities.

Consequently, it is imperative to establish robust ethical principles for the deployment of AI that safeguard women's data privacy and reduce the risk of discrimination. This requires a multi-faceted strategy that includes partnership between governments, tech companies, researchers, and civil society organizations.
